How to request a copy of a certificate

A birth, death or marriage entry is held in Register Office in the district where the event took place. Visit the government’s website to find the right register office.

If the event you are looking for took place outside of Slough, you should contact the relevant registration district. They will be able to help you.

If you are requesting a copy of a marriage certificate where the marriage took place in a religious building recently, then we may not yet have a deposited register from the church or temple. In these cases, you should request your copy certificate from the church or temple directly. We can tell you if you need to do this when you apply for your copy certificate.

How to get a copy of a certificate

By post

Your letter should contain the following information for each certificate being applied for:

  • name of the person (and the name of their partner in the case of a marriage or civil partnership).
  • date and type of the event (birth, death, marriage or civil partnership).
  • place of birth or death.
  • for a marriage or civil partnership, the location where the ceremony took place. For example the church, the register office or an approved venue like a hotel.

In person

You can apply in person at our office during our normal opening hours - check contact us for details.

By telephone

You can contact us by telephone to order a copy certificate.
